Julian Cheung and Anita Yuen’s son Morton has attracted quite a bit of attention for his appearance, from his height to his worryingly thin frame, in recent years.

The teen, who turned 15 on November 12, took to Instagram yesterday (Nov 14) to share snippets of his birthday celebration with his friends.

“Blowing out candles the Covid-free way, he captioned the post.

In the video, Morton can be seen posing with three cakes while his friends sing him the birthday song. He then pulls out a candle from one of the cakes before shaking it to snuff out the flame.

    It's not like people haven't tried getting Morton to be a star.

    According to reports, advertisers have taken interest in Morton since he was a kid, but his parents turned them all down as they want him to have a happy childhood.

    Julian also said before that he doesn’t want Morton to follow in their footsteps ‘cos there is too much pressure in showbiz.

    Anita, on the other hand, said that it is hard to predict what would happen in the future when it comes to her son's career path, but she would tell him that becoming an artiste is not as easy as it seems.
